Factors Affecting Cost

House raising in Rocklin, CA, involves elevating a residence to protect against flooding, improve foundation stability, or prepare for renovations. The scope and complexity of these projects can vary based on the building’s size, materials used,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.

  • Materials: Typically involves reinforced wood, steel supports, and foundation components suitable for residential structures in Rocklin.
  • Size and Scope: Ranges from small single-story homes to larger multi-level residences, impacting the overall project scale.
  • Labor Complexity: Depends on the structure’s design, foundation type, and site conditions, influencing the level of technical expertise required.
  • Permitting: Usually requires local permits from Rocklin city authorities, ensuring compliance with building codes and regulations.
  • Additional Elements: May include foundation repairs, utility disconnects and reconnections, and site cleanup, which can add to overall project costs.
